Whenever a young player arrives in Indian cricket, the heartbeats of fans and experts increase, but when it comes to Vaibhav Suryavanshi, the record-breaking hero of Bihar who was just 15 years old, then the level of excitement reaches the seventh sky. Recently, former national selector of Team India, Saba Karim has given a very sensational and big statement regarding Vaibhav’s international debut.

In a special conversation with News18 Hindi, Saba Karim said that Vaibhav Suryavanshi is not just an ordinary player but a global superstar of the future and a place for him will have to be made in the playing eleven of the Indian team at any cost. Generally, a lot of thought is given to young players before giving them a direct opportunity at the international level. Often he is made to sit on the bench as a backup to senior players, but Saba Karim has deviated from this tradition and expressed his frank opinion.

Make room for Suryavanshi like Sachin

The former selector said in clear words that you will have to vacate space in the team for a champion batsman like Vaibhav. You cannot waste his time and his confidence by making him sit on the bench. He is such a special talent, who has the ability to play directly in the playing eleven. Giving the example of Sachin Tendulkar, Saba Karim said that when Sachin came to the team, a place was made for him too, now the team management will have to do the same work for Suryavanshi. This statement of Saba Karim shows how much faith the giants have in Vaibhav’s aggressive batting style and ability to win matches.

Battle of Vaibhav Suryavanshi vs Joffra Archer

While talking to News 18 Hindi, Saba Karim revealed that the cricket fans of England and the media there are desperate to see Vaibhav Suryavanshi’s game. There is a special clash that everyone is eagerly waiting for on the soil of England. The match between Vaibhav Suryavanshi’s aggressive timing versus Joffra Archer’s speed will be special in many ways. Jofra Archer is known for his 150 km/hr speed, sharp bouncers and deadly yorkers, while on the other hand, Vaibhav is famous for his fearless batting. It is going to be really exciting to see how a young Indian batsman faces the fiery balls like Archer on the bouncy pitches of England. Former England greats also believe that this match will prove to be the biggest ‘X-factor’ of the series. Archer has bowled to Vaibhav in the nets of Rajasthan Royals and for the first time he will bowl against him in the match.
